Return to Paradise is a classic movie from 1953 that stars the legendary actor, Gary Cooper. It is a story about a World War II veteran named Mark Fallon (Gary Cooper) who visits the island of Matareva where he had served during the war. However, he finds that things have changed since he was last there. The island is now under the control of the French who have imposed strict laws and regulations on the inhabitants. Despite this, Mark finds himself falling in love with a local woman named Iva (Roberta Haynes). She is the daughter of the island's former chief and is engaged to a man named Malenga (Barry Jones). Malenga is a wealthy trader who has made a fortune off the backs of the islanders.

Mark is immediately drawn to Iva's beauty and charm, and soon finds himself competing against Malenga for her affections. However, when Malenga learns of Mark's intentions, he becomes hostile towards him and threatens to have him banished from the island.

As Mark tries to win Iva's heart, he also becomes aware of the injustices that the islanders are facing under the French rule. The French soldiers have taken over the island and are imposing their laws on the islanders, including the banning of their traditional dances and festivals.

Despite the islanders' attempts to rebel against the French, they are met with force and violence. Mark becomes increasingly involved in the islanders' struggle for freedom, and soon finds himself caught between his love for Iva and his desire to help the islanders.
